Background Gynaecological cancers may be the sentinel malignancy in women who carry a mutation in BRCA1 or 2, a mis-match repair gene causing Lynch Syndrome or other genes. Despite published guidelines for referral to a genetics service, a substantial number of women do not attend for the recommended genetic assessment. Complete cytoreductive surgery (CRS) and adjuvant chemotherapy is and has been the backbone of treatment for advanced ovarian epithelial and primary peritoneal carcinomatosis for many years. Studies have shown that adjuvant intraperitoneal chemotherapy has significant survival advantages over standard intravenous chemotherapy but has been incompletely adopted due to side effects. Primary screening based on detection of human papillomavirus (HPV) has proved to be more sensitive than cytology for the detection of high-grade cervical intraepithelial neoplasia (CIN). Self-sampling for specimen collection may also improve the participation rate, especially in the non-responder group.
